Transcription of the Will of David Hann, aka David Hans, aka David Honn

In the Name of God Amen
I David Hans Seaman No S. B. 922 belonging
to H. M. Ship Bellerophon Henry D. Darby Esqr. Captain
being in Bodily Health amd of sound and disposing Mind
and Memory and considering the perils and dangers
the Seas and other uncertainties of this Transitory
Life Do for avoiding Controversies after my decease
make publish and declare this my last Will and
Testament in manner following that is to say ffirst
I commit to the Earth or Sea as it shall please God
to order And as for and concerning all my Worldly
Estate I give bequeath and dispose thereof that is to
say All the Wages Sum and Sums of Money Lands
Tenements Goods Chattels and Estate whatsoever as shall
be any ways due owing or belonging unto me at the
time of my decease I do give devise and bequeath
the same unto my beloved sister Mary Gale Burton
Dorset And I do hereby nominate and appoint her the
said Mary Gale Executrix of this my last Will and
Testament hereby revoking all former and other Wills
Testaments and Deeds of Gifts by me at any time
heretofore made And I do ordain and ratify these
presents to stand and be for as my last Will and
Testament In Witness whereof to this my said Will
I have set my Hand and Seal the seventh day of
October in the year of Our Lord One thousand seven
Hundred amd ninety six and in the thirty sixth year of
the Reign of his Majesty King George the Third
over Great Britain David Honn signed sealed
published and declared in the presence of H D Darby
James Hiatt Purser
